Atkinson Academy was founded in Atkinson, N.H. in 1787 by three professional men, Rev. Stephen Peabody (1741-1819), Gen. Nathaniel Peabody (1741-1823), and Dr. William Cogswell (1760-1831). The Academy began its first term in 1789, but was not incorporated until 17 February 1791, at which point it became co-educational. The Academy closed in 1949.
